Awash with Flowers is a two step stamping set. I started the card by stamping the solid image larger flower and the line image of the same flower inked with the Apricot Appeal Classic Stamp Pad randomly on the Apricot Appeal Card Stock. Then I added a layer of Almost Amethyst Card Stock that had the corners rounded with our 3/16" Corner Rounder Punch. The Scalloped Whisper White Card Stock was made with the Big Shot and the Clear Scallop Square Die. I used the Basic Gray Classic Stamp Pad to stamp the flower image and stem. Then I stamped the solid portion of the flower and leaves with the Almost Amethyst Classic Stamp Pad and the Mellow Moss Classic Stamp Pad. I added a knotted piece of Apricot Appeal Grosgrain 1/4" Ribbon. The for you sentiment is from the All Holidays Stamp Set, it was stamped with the Basic Gray Classic Stamp Pad on Whisper White Card Stock then punched out with the Small Oval Punch and added to the card with Mini Glue Dots.
